About Begumpet, Hyderabad

Set in the older mid-city belt of Hyderabad, Begumpet sits along Sardar Patel Road with Ameerpet to the west and Somajiguda and Secunderabad nearby. It is in Telangana. The PIN code is 500016. In city tables, the locality ranks 65 out of 837 neighbourhoods, with a current area score of 4.2. Daily needs are handled inside the neighbourhood, with markets, clinics, and schools along the main streets.


New housing continues to enter the market. There are 337 new projects, while 3 projects are still on site, and 41 are already ready to move in.
Choice spans across 6 property types, including apartments, villas, builder floors, etc., with a logged count of 236. For buyers, there are 91 homes on the market; tenants see 145 rentals. Typical sale quotes centre on ₹ 9,600/Sq. Ft., with most deals closing inside ₹ 7 L to 14.5 Cr. Rents asking bands usually fall within ₹ 6,000 to 1.1 L per month.


Daily movement leans on Blue Line stops at Begumpet and Prakash Nagar, with Ameerpet as the interchange. TSRTC buses run on SP Road. Begumpet Railway Station provides MMTS access. The airport trip by road is roughly 30–36 kilometres. Main links include Sardar Patel Road, the Raj Bhavan–Greenlands belt, and the Panjagutta–Begumpet corridor.


Infrastructure, Connectivity & Transport


Begumpet offers good road, rail, and metro coverage. Main roads such as Sardar Patel Road, Panjagutta–Begumpet Road, and the Raj Bhavan–Greenlands area connect it to business and residential areas. The Hyderabad Metro’s Blue Line runs through the region, with stops at Begumpet and Prakash Nagar, and an interchange at Ameerpet. Begumpet Railway Station connects to MMTS; nearby MMTS stops include Sanjeevaiah Park and James Street. Begumpet Airport now handles training and charter flights; commercial traffic moved to Shamshabad.


The Begumpet/Greenlands flyover is one of the older city flyovers. The road grid spans NH-44 and NH-65, Sardar Patel Road, the Raj Bhavan–Greenlands belt, Panjagutta–Begumpet Road, and Minister Road to Tank Bund and Necklace Road. Notable places include ITC Kakatiya and GreenPark (hotels), The Hyderabad Public School (Begumpet) and St. Francis College (institutions), and hospitals such as Yashoda Somajiguda and KIMS. Shopping clusters sit around Hyderabad Central and GVK One.

Why Choose Begumpet for Living? Advantages & Considerations

What is Great?

  • The locality has good public transport options ranging from metro service to government buses
  • Gowtham Model School situated near the locality has very good drama and sports clubs
  • Vinn Multispeciality hospital is situated near the locality that open 24 hours and also has ambulance support
  • Ratnadeep Supermarket has all the daily essentials available in the locality
  • Pingale Public park has a good picnic spot with good greenery

What is Concerning?

  • Traffic congestion during peak hours
  • Many of the parks don’t have dustbins which leads to garbage on the grass
  • There are very less vet clinics in this locality
  • Waterlogging occurs during monsoons due to poor drainage system
  • Some roads have potholes

FAQs

Q: What is Begumpet, Hyderabad, famous for?

Begumpet is known for central access, Blue Line metro stops, and heritage landmarks.

Q: Which part of Hyderabad is Begumpet?

It lies in Telangana's central belt.

Q: Is Begumpet costly?

Begumpet is moderately expensive, with prime streets priced higher than many suburban areas. Recent sale prices range from ₹7 lakh to ₹14.5 crore, and typical rents range from ₹6,000 to ₹1.1 lakh per month.

Q: What is the PIN code of Begumpet, Hyderabad?

The area is served by PIN 500016.

Q: Is Begumpet, Hyderabad, a good place to live?

Yes, Begumpet is considered a good place to live, with a livability score of 4.4/5 and a connectivity score of 4.8/5. Blue Line stops at Begumpet and Prakash Nagar; MMTS runs from Begumpet Railway Station, and links via Sardar Patel Road, NH 44, and NH 65 make daily travel simple, though peak-hour traffic occurs around Greenlands.
